Need Help Adding a DID on my Nortel MICS 7.0 Telephone System.

imwadej (TechnicalUser)
31 Jul 12 15:27
I have a Nortel MICS Telephone System with 7.0 Software. I have a PRI with several DID numbers assigned. I am needing to reassign one of the DID numbewrs to another extension. Can anuone help me?

exsmogger (Vendor)
31 Jul 12 22:00
Look under Terminals & Sets - Line Access - Line Assignment. Unassign the target line from the current extension and then assign to the new extension.

curlycord (Programmer)
1 Aug 12 8:37
Target lines start at 157
One you assign the target then SHOW again and add as many appearances as needed
i.e give reception 4 or 5 on mid size system.

You may want to go under Lines and change the Prime set as well to equal the set you assigned.

Crowtalks (TechnicalUser)
1 Aug 12 14:23
To build upon curlycord...

Each taget line is assigned to ring, A&R or APP just as loop lines in the terminal & sets programming field. To find what target line a particular DID is assoiciated with, look at the DN and see what target line is assigned to it.

Each DID is assigned in the system as a received number within a particular target line, and that target line is then assigned to a prime set under that individual target line.
